Transaction 65cbc33732601765e121262e03150576d789309122c26be3e31c3e4d023ac876
1 Input
1 Output
-
65cbc33732601765e121262e03150576d789309122c26be3e31c3e4d023ac876:0
- value
- 3016530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0063446b1c711a6fe8a571dfa5626af952805235 OP_EQUAL
- address
- 31j4qkgDFrQa1dREgphEXApgETQeKaMwKV